eighty-two million, nine hundred ninety-two thousand, three hundred twenty-eight
Currency $82992328 in american english: eighty-two million, nine hundred ninety-two thousand, three hundred twenty-eight US Dollars.
In Price: 82992328.00
81992328 | 83992328